  • So, living in China and that life here has got me thinking about raising a family and all that jazz. Chale, the cultural differences alone are like, out of this world, medaase. But let me break down how it’s been, 'cos family life here is not your typical African village setup.

    One thing, the schedules are serious in China; everything runs like a well-oiled machine. For kids, that means a lot of school, even on weekends sometimes. The focus is on academics, no time to waste. The pressure! But these shortcuts can be pushing stars, they fall and fly all at the same time

    Good thing is, you get support from the community in raising the kids. They got this collective rearing where everyone pitches in. It's random, but it works, abi? Imagine your neighbour dropping the kids at school when they're not feeling well or something. To the point where your child might just share the basic bio facts, but they're like half-siblings with the whole street because everyone claims ‘mumu'.

    Teaching them the language has been an adventure, plenty of L's taken. But when you see them transition - from ya fun twi and pidginๅคนๆ‚ๆ™ฎ้€š่ฏ - to speaking like mini Chinese national treasures, it’s all worth it. I’ve named this game Triple Lingual Toddlers.

    Family outings are top-notch too. Visiting ancient sites is basically like living history books. I'm talking about, just yesterday, we took the kids to the Great Wall, and they got to feel the weight of yesteryears on their little shoulders.

    On the flip side, there’s this fine line of balancing the Chinese way and the African way of raising kids. Respect for elders and traditional African values are a constant dance with modern Chinese education. The clash is real but learning how to mesh them is like a full-time gig

    I’d say, family life in China, it keeps you on your toes, but there’s a kind of magic in making these cultures fit like a puzzle - and our kids? The living, breathing evidence of that magic. What’s your take, o? Feel free to share your own family stories or thoughts in China. Let’s chop this up.
